Sydney man in court for animal cruelty

A man will appear in a Sydney court charged with various animal cruelty offences. (AAP)

A man will appear in a Sydney court charged with animal cruelty offences after a cat was found injured in the CBD.

Sydney City Police Area Command officers commenced an investigation after a 22-year-old woman found her cat injured in a unit on Broadway, Ultimo, about 4pm on Saturday.

Three-year-old Summer the cat had injuries including broken teeth, facial bruising and fur missing from his tail.

He was taken to a local vet for treatment.

Police later arrested a 25-year-old man - known to the woman - at a home in Hurstville, in southern Sydney, about 12.30am on Sunday.

He was taken to Kogarah Police Station and charged with recklessly beat and seriously injures animal and commit an act of cruelty upon an animal.

He was refused bail to appear at Parramatta Bail Court later on Sunday.
